SAVOUR LAND & SEA CINQUE TERRE, ITALY In Cinque Terre, delight in breathtaking views of villages that comprise this extraordinary area that has been deemed a UNESCO protected territory. Then, pair the sights with exquisite delights. The Gulf of La Spezia is famous for growing mussels and for preparing them in a truly unique way: stuffed. The mussels are opened, the meat is split, and a savoury spoonful of stuffing made of cheese, herbs, breadcrumbs and ground mussels is placed in the shell and then simmered in tomato sauce. Cinque Terre’s namesake white wine pairs perfectly with the mussels and the rest of the delicious seafood of the region.
